Sample content
Photography is inherently visual, but search engines are fundamentally text-based. This creates a paradox: the better your portfolio looks, the less Google can understand it without supporting text content.
Blog content bridges this gap. Articles about wedding planning, session preparation, and photography tips provide the searchable text that brings visitors to your site — where your portfolio does the rest of the selling.
The seasonal nature of photography makes content even more valuable. Off-season articles about planning and preparation capture clients who will book for peak season, keeping your pipeline full year-round.
Industry insight
Photographers have been among the hardest hit by social media algorithm changes. Accounts that once reached thousands organically now struggle for visibility without paid promotion.
The photographers thriving in this new landscape are those who diversified into SEO-driven content. Blog articles about wedding planning, session guides, and photography education create permanent search visibility that no algorithm change can take away.
